  8. I too had my first fill at 6 wks out. My surgeon will do fills every 4 wks or more. My second fill ended up being at 5 wks due to Thanksgiving holiday. And my third fill is scheduled for 1/9 because of the Christmas and New Year holidays. I would make special note of any increase in appetite, and hunger between meals before your next scheduled appointment. If you are not being satisfied, and staying full for 4 hours between meals you should say so and request a fill.
